Orlando Pirates CAF Confederations Cup opponents Enyimba have received a massive boost from the Nigeria Professional Football League just days before their clash.

To allow the Nigerian giants more time to prepare for their clash against the Buccaneers, the NPFL match week 15 fixture between Enyimba and MFM, has been postponed, giving the Nigerians more time to prepare for Wednesday's match at the Orlando Stadium.
In a statement on their official website, Enyimba confirmed that their league match has been postponed accommodating their clash against Pirates.
"The game which was originally scheduled for the Agege Stadium on Sunday 14th March, has been moved to a yet to be decided date by the League Management Company to allow Enyimba honour their CAF Confederation Cup group A fixture against Orlando Pirates in South Africa," the statement read in part.
This equals the playing field for both sides, with Pirates also enjoying a full seven-day rest, a rarity in their congested schedule.
Enyimba currently sit atop Group A following their 2-1 win against Al Ahly Benghazi, while second placed Pirates had to settle for a goalless draw against Algeria's ES Sétif.

The two sides will face off at the Orlando Stadium in Soweto on Wednesday, with kickoff scheduled for 5pm, while the return leg takes place in April at a venue which is yet to be decided.
